You can replace with a 1.6 from a Tracker or even a 4.3 liter Vortec V6. For diesel, 1.8 to 2.0 liter older VW engines can be swapped as well. Most of these need some adaption that is readily available.

To reset the check engine light on a Suzuki Samurai, you can disconnect the battery for about 10-15 minutes. This will clear the vehicle’s memory and reset the light. Alternatively, you can use an OBD-II scanner to read and clear any di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s) that may have triggered the light. Always ensure to address the underlying issue that caused the light to turn on before resetting.
The gas tank capacity of a Suzuki Samurai is typically around 10.5 gallons (approximately 39.7 liters). This capacity can slightly vary depending on the model year and specific configuration. The Samurai is known for its compact size and off-road capabilities, making its fuel tank size suitable for its intended use.

For a Suzuki Samurai transmission, it is recommended to use API GL-4 gear oil, typically with a viscosity of 75W-90. Some owners also prefer using synthetic options for better performance and protection. Always check the owner’s manual for specific recommendations based on your model year and driving conditions.
